Output 66a8a338a4a1ae264a2361ef0619bfa6a8de72ec5f9d26dcf24b91fef6ef729f:3

value
1661500
script pubkey
OP_0 OP_PUSHBYTES_20 3927ae6f1d5dac7c7b0d11119a239ec1392a507c
address
bc1q8yn6umcatkk8c7cdzyge5gu7cyuj55ru3zx52m
transaction
66a8a338a4a1ae264a2361ef0619bfa6a8de72ec5f9d26dcf24b91fef6ef729f